Understanding Pink Sapphire: Pink Sapphire is a variety of the mineral corundum, renowned for its hardness and durability. While the classic blue Sapphire is widely recognized, the Pink Sapphire stands out with its charming blush tones, ranging from delicate pastels to vibrant fuchsia. The color intensity and evenness play a crucial role in determining the value of a Pink Sapphire.

Factors to Consider:

  1. Color: The color of a Pink Sapphire is the most crucial factor to evaluate. Seek stones with a pleasing and uniform pink hue, free from undesirable undertones such as brown or gray.

  2. Clarity: Like all gemstones, Pink Sapphires may contain natural inclusions. Look for stones with good clarity, ensuring that the inclusions do not compromise the gem's beauty or durability.

  3. Cut: The cut of a Pink Sapphire significantly impacts its brilliance and overall appearance. Well-cut stones maximize the gem's light reflection and shine, enhancing its visual impact.

  4. Carat Weight: Pink Sapphires are available in various sizes, and the carat weight affects both the price and the visual impact. Consider your budget and personal preferences when choosing the appropriate size.

Authenticity and Quality Assurance:

To ensure you're purchasing a genuine Pink Sapphire of high quality, it's essential to rely on reputable jewelers. Look for established vendors who provide certifications from reputable gemological laboratories, such as GIA (Gemological Institute of America) or AGS (American Gem Society). These certifications offer valuable information about the gem's authenticity, color grading, and any treatments it may have undergone.

Treatment and Enhancement:

It's important to be aware that Pink Sapphires often undergo treatment processes to enhance their color and clarity. Common treatments include heat treatment and lattice diffusion. While these treatments are widely accepted within the industry, it's crucial to inquire about any treatments the gemstone has undergone before making your purchase.

Care and Maintenance:

Pink Sapphires, like all gemstones, require proper care to maintain their brilliance over time. Avoid exposing your Pink Sapphire to harsh chemicals or extreme temperatures, as these can damage the gemstone. Regularly clean it with mild soapy water and a soft brush, and store it separately from other jewelry pieces to prevent scratches.
